- W2068089526 abstract "The relationship between terpene content in Pinus caribaea needles and Atta laevigata herbivory was examined. Analysis of newly defoliated (foraged) pines revealed that the concentrations of myrcene and caryophyllene were lower than in undefoliated (non-foraged) trees. Four months later, the same defoliated pines were found to contain larger concentrations of α-cubebene, α-copaene, γ-muurolene, β-cadinene, and smaller amounts of myrcene than the previously sampled undefoliated trees. Intraspecific terpene variation may play an important role in pine selectively by leafcutter ants and it is also possible that defoliation might induce changes in the terpene composition of pine needles." @default.
